Dangers of Poor Eyesight

John Esch, sitting behind the wheel of an automobile, adjusting his eyeglasses while smoking a tobacco pipe. Photograph taken for International Harvester's Agricultural Extension Department to illustrate the dangers of driving with impaired eyesight. |

Original typewritten caption reads: "Farm Hazards. Defective sight causes accidents. John Esch." Photograph taken for International Harvester's Agricultural Extension Department. |
